Features of the different stages (i. e. , 1 to 5) of sleep. Transition period; lasts 5-10 mins; see things, but not dreaming; easily awaken, eyes move slowly under lids; brain waves rapid and low voltage. Slower, more regular brain wave patterns; sleep spindles: increases in brain wave frequency; eye movements stop; heart rate slows; body temp drops.
